[dm-devel] multipath-tools ./multipath.conf.defaults libm ...

bmarzins at sourceware.org bmarzins at sourceware.org
Fri Nov 12 20:17:12 UTC 2010


CVSROOT:	/cvs/dm
Module name:	multipath-tools
Branch: 	RHEL5_FC6
Changes by:	bmarzins at sourceware.org	2010-11-12 20:17:12

Modified files:
	.              : multipath.conf.defaults 
	libmultipath   : hwtable.c 

Log message:
	Fix for bz #647358. Update and add HP default configurations

Patches:
http://sourceware.org/cgi-bin/cvsweb.cgi/multipath-tools/multipath.conf.defaults.diff?cvsroot=dm&only_with_tag=RHEL5_FC6&r1=1.5.4.27&r2=1.5.4.28
http://sourceware.org/cgi-bin/cvsweb.cgi/multipath-tools/libmultipath/hwtable.c.diff?cvsroot=dm&only_with_tag=RHEL5_FC6&r1=1.20.2.33&r2=1.20.2.34

--- multipath-tools/multipath.conf.defaults	2010/09/21 18:06:04	1.5.4.27
+++ multipath-tools/multipath.conf.defaults	2010/11/12 20:17:09	1.5.4.28
@@ -59,7 +59,7 @@
 #       }
 #       device {
 #               vendor                  "(COMPAQ|HP)"
-#               product                 "HSV1[01]1|HSV2[01]0|HSV300|HSV4[05]0"
+#               product                 "HSV1[01]1|HSV2[01]0|HSV3[046]0|HSV4[05]0"
 #		getuid_callout		"/sbin/scsi_id -g -u -s /block/%n"
 #               prio_callout            "/sbin/mpath_prio_alua /dev/%n"	
 #		features		"0"
@@ -67,7 +67,7 @@
 #               path_grouping_policy    group_by_prio
 #		failback		immediate
 #		rr_weight		uniform
-#               no_path_retry		12 
+#               no_path_retry		18
 #		rr_min_io		100
 #               path_checker            tur
 #        }
@@ -163,6 +163,20 @@
 #		path_checker		cciss_tur
 #	}
 #       device {
+#               vendor                  "HP"
+#               product                 "P2000 G3*|P2000G3 FC/iSCSI"
+#		getuid_callout		"/sbin/scsi_id -g -u -s /block/%n"
+#               prio_callout            "/sbin/mpath_prio_alua /dev/%n"
+#		features		"0"
+#		hardware_handler	"0"
+#               path_grouping_policy    group_by_prio
+#		failback		immediate
+#		rr_weight		uniform
+#               no_path_retry		18
+#		rr_min_io		100
+#               path_checker            tur
+#        }
+#       device {
 #               vendor                  "DDN"
 #               product                 "SAN DataDirector"
 #		getuid_callout		"/sbin/scsi_id -g -u -s /block/%n"
--- multipath-tools/libmultipath/hwtable.c	2010/09/21 18:06:05	1.20.2.33
+++ multipath-tools/libmultipath/hwtable.c	2010/11/12 20:17:12	1.20.2.34
@@ -91,9 +91,9 @@
 		.checker_name  = HP_SW,
 	},
 	{
-		/* EVA 3000/5000 with new firmware, EVA 4000/6000/8000, EVA 4400 */
+		/* EVA 3000/5000 with new firmware, EVA 4x00/6x00/8x00 */
 		.vendor        = "(COMPAQ|HP)",
-		.product       = "HSV1[01]1|HSV2[01]0|HSV300|HSV4[05]|HSV4[05]0",
+		.product       = "HSV1[01]1|HSV2[01]0|HSV3[046]0|HSV4[05]0",
 		.getuid        = DEFAULT_GETUID,
 		.getprio       = "/sbin/mpath_prio_alua /dev/%n",
 		.features      = DEFAULT_FEATURES,
@@ -102,7 +102,7 @@
 		.pgpolicy      = GROUP_BY_PRIO,
 		.pgfailback    = -FAILBACK_IMMEDIATE,
 		.rr_weight     = RR_WEIGHT_NONE,
-		.no_path_retry = 12,
+		.no_path_retry = 18,
 		.minio         = 100,
 		.checker_name  = TUR,
 	},
@@ -201,6 +201,22 @@
 		.minio         = DEFAULT_MINIO,
 		.checker_name  = CCISS_TUR,
 	},
+	{
+		/* HP P2000 product family */
+		.vendor        = "HP",
+		.product       = "P2000 G3*|P2000G3 FC/iSCSI",
+		.getuid        = DEFAULT_GETUID,
+		.getprio       = "/sbin/mpath_prio_alua /dev/%n",
+		.features      = DEFAULT_FEATURES,
+		.hwhandler     = DEFAULT_HWHANDLER,
+		.selector      = DEFAULT_SELECTOR,
+		.pgpolicy      = GROUP_BY_PRIO,
+		.pgfailback    = -FAILBACK_IMMEDIATE,
+		.rr_weight     = RR_WEIGHT_NONE,
+		.no_path_retry = 18,
+		.minio         = 100,
+		.checker_name  = TUR,
+	},
 	/*
 	 * DDN controller family
 	 *




More information about the dm-devel mailing list